OPEN INNOVATION
Open innovation is considered to be a new perceptions towards the innovation. Open
innovation refers to the term through which information sharing is done with the intention of
acquiring more knowledge (Sigala, 2016). It is done for the purpose of enhancing the markets as
well as innovation in products and services. It lead researchers or companies to do share their
unique findings or ideas with others. Open innovation is a managed sharing information flows
between various organizations in order to improve their business model by doing something new.
So many companies are looking for this approach in order to make their business competitive for
others (French, Teal and Raman, 2016).
CO-INNOVATION
Co-innovation is an innovation approach in which company disrupt its business and
industry by innovating directly with another company partners or customers. It involves defining
and executing new innovative offerings through products and services which lead to exceed the
sum of whole organizationals' parts (Brasseur, Mladenow and Strauss, 2017). The company who
is doing co-innovation at the same time, try to compete with another company in order to lead
the market. Co-innovation can be understand as 1 + 1 = 3. It's another name is Coupled Open
Innovation, which means both companies have to share knowledge with each others in order to
produce some innovative products or services.

ONLINE OPEN INNOVATION PLATFORM
Online open innovation platform refers to the platform which are made up of various
factors. These factors help companies to communicate, co-operate and share tasks, knowledge,
skills and resources in order to perform various activities which is required to carry out for the
innovation at the online level (Bissola, Imperatori and Biffi, 2017). It is done for the purpose of
coming up with new solutions or new methods or new products. There are various open
innovation platforms which is being used by various companies online. It is helpful in providing
medium or tool through which companies are able to produce new ideas and accordingly do
innovation in the market (Edwards, Logue and Schweitzer, 2015).
STRENGTHS AND WEAKNESSES OF ONLINE OPEN INNOVATION PLATFORM
An online open innovation platform is very important for the success of the business.
There are various strengths and weaknesses of online open innovation platform which are such
as -
STRENGTHS OF ONLINE OPEN INNOVATION PLATFORM
There are various strengths which are as follows -
Vast amount of Knowledge – Due to digital technologies being used in these online platforms,
there are vast amount of knowledge available which lead companies to get ideas in order to make
their business process, aspect or product-service innovative.
Saving of Time and Money – Due to availability of knowledge in the platforms easily, company
don't need to do research regarding innovation or products which results in saving of time as well
as money which companies can use in another important business activities.
Strong customer relationships – This is an open platforms where any stakeholders or parties
related to the companies can provide knowledge or acquire knowledge. This will help company
to do innovation in their products accordingly. This make customers to fulfil their needs which
results in strengthen the relationships between customers and companies.
Strong Employer Brand Image – When companies are able to do innovation in their products or
any business aspects. This lead to enhancement in market shares, profitability and brand value of
the company. It will affect the company's employer brand image and it will be helpful in
companies to get good employees for their business (Journée and Weber, 2017).

Give Arise to Internally Conflict – There are various management team working under the
organization who don't like to share their knowledge or experiences with another people who are
working for another companies. These platforms lead to trouble those people which results in
arisen of conflicts within the organization.
No Confidentiality – Due to easily accessibility to these online open innovation platforms to
anybody, there is no confidentiality of knowledge or data which lead to sometimes acquire of
wrong information or data in the system in which these platforms are running.
Popularity Misleading – Due to easily accessible to knowledge, if any company is getting new
ideas from wrong knowledge. This lead company to bear a lot of loss as well as cost too. It also
lead to risk of brand image and popularity of the firm. It also affects the project or research
management of organization.
Danger of Manipulation – It has biggest weakness which is “Danger of Manipulation”. It helps
in minimizing the risk of the innovative ideas being manipulative. But these platforms are
handling by qualified communities(Dangers of manipulation, 2019). Otherwise , competitors can
spread wrong information on these platforms regarding the company and its projects which lead
to manipulation of company as well as customers (Mirvis and et.al., 2016).
